The Stuyvesant High School Online Course Guide |
Who Should take this
course?
This is a one-year course is
for incoming freshmen who wish to learn to play a band instrument.
What will we be
The main objective of the course is
to give students an appreciation of music by "doing." It is expected
that by the end of this one-year course, students will be able to
perform simple ensemble pieces with good intonation, tone production,
phrasing, dynamics, and expression.
How is the course
Classes meet daily for a full
credit. Students are expected to attend on time, daily, and prepared,
unless legally excused.
Are there any special demands,
costs,
Students are expected to supply
their own mouthpieces and, in some cases, neck straps. In addition,
inexpensive method books may also be needed. Students are also
expected to support the Music Department by helping to sell
tickets to, and attending, Department events.
Details and pre/co-
Successful completion of this
one-year course will fulfill the Music Appreciation
(U1) requirement. No prior experience on woodwind or brass
instruments is expected. Other musical experience (such as piano) is
desirable, but not necessary.
